Bitcoin Basics

Bitcoin is a decentralized digital currency that allows for secure, peer-to-peer transactions without the need for a central authority, such as a bank or government. Created in 2009 by an anonymous person or group known as Satoshi Nakamoto, it was the first cryptocurrency to successfully solve the "double-spending" problem through a distributed ledger system. Unlike traditional fiat currencies like the US Dollar or Euro, Bitcoin is not printed; instead, it is "mined" by computers globally using specialized software. Each individual Bitcoin is divisible into 100,000,000 smaller units called satoshis, making it accessible for both large-scale institutional investments and small everyday transactions.

The Blockchain Technology

At the heart of Bitcoin is the blockchain, a shared public ledger that records every transaction ever made on the network. Think of it as a global spreadsheet that everyone can view, but no single entity can edit or delete. When a person sends Bitcoin to another, the transaction is broadcast to the network. These transactions are then grouped together into "blocks." Once a block is verified by miners, it is added to the previous block, creating a chronological chain. This structure ensures transparency and immutability, meaning that once a transaction is confirmed, it cannot be reversed or tampered with.

Wallets and Keys

To interact with the Bitcoin network, users utilize digital wallets. A wallet does not actually "store" the Bitcoins—since they only exist as records on the blockchain—but rather stores the cryptographic credentials used to access them. These credentials consist of a public key, which acts like an email address or account number that others can see to send you funds, and a private key. The private key serves as a digital signature or password. It is essential to keep this key secret, as anyone with access to it has total control over the funds associated with that address. Mining Process

Bitcoin mining is the process by which new bitcoins are entered into circulation and is also a critical component of the maintenance and development of the blockchain ledger. It is performed using very sophisticated hardware that solves an extremely complex computational math problem. The first computer to find the solution to the problem receives the next block of bitcoins and the process begins again. This "Proof of Work" system ensures that the network remains secure, as it would require an immense amount of computational power for any malicious actor to alter the transaction history.

Network Security

The decentralized nature of mining means that there are thousands of "nodes" or computers running the Bitcoin software worldwide. These nodes verify that transactions follow the rules of the network, such as ensuring the sender has enough balance and that the digital signatures are valid. Because there is no central server, the network has no single point of failure. This distributed consensus system is what makes Bitcoin one of the most secure financial networks in existence. As the difficulty of mining increases over time, miners must use more efficient hardware to stay profitable, which in turn further strengthens the network's total hashing power.

Economic Incentives

Miners are rewarded in two ways: through newly created Bitcoins (the block reward) and through transaction fees paid by users. Every four years, an event called the "halving" occurs, which cuts the block reward in half. This mechanism is designed to control inflation and mimic the scarcity of precious metals. Growth Drivers

The primary driver for long-term value is scarcity. With a hard cap of 21 million coins, Bitcoin is a disinflationary asset. As global demand increases—whether from institutional investors, retail users in developing economies, or as a reserve asset for smaller nations—the fixed supply exerts upward pressure on the price. Furthermore, technological improvements like the Lightning Network, which allows for near-instant and low-cost transactions, are expanding Bitcoin's utility beyond just a store of value and into a functional medium of exchange for daily commerce. User Privacy

One of the original draws of Bitcoin was the level of privacy it offered. While every transaction is public on the blockchain, the identities of the individuals involved are not directly recorded. However, as the industry has matured, most major exchanges now require "Know Your Customer" (KYC) documentation to comply with international anti-money laundering laws. This has made the network safer and more transparent, helping it gain broader acceptance in the global financial system. Today's users must balance the benefits of decentralization with the practical requirements of interacting with regulated financial entities to ensure their assets remain secure and accessible.
